    25, COWLEAZE, CHINNOR, OX39 4TB

    This semi-detached freehold property on Cowleaze last sold in December 2022 for £432,500. Based on price growth in the OX39 district since then, its estimated current value is £438,329 — placing it in the 72nd percentile nationally and the 35th percentile within OX39. The property covers 89 m² (958 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£4,925 per m². The EPC rating is D, with a potential rating of B.
